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Red Hat JBoss Operations Network version 3.3.1
Description
The issue all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ary Java methods or cause a denial of service due to improper access restriction to certain APIs. This can be achieved via the ServerInvokerServlet, SchedulerService, or by exploiting the ContentManager, leading to disk consumption.
Recommendations
For Red Hat JBoss Operations Network version 3.3.1, consider restricting access to the ServerInvokerServlet, SchedulerService, and ContentManager to minimize the risk of exploitation. As a temporary workaround, limit the use of these components until a proper fix is applied.
